First water report of year credits late-Dec. storms with improving snowpack outlook

Published January 8, 2009, 11:34 pm, The Times-News

Late-December snowstorms have brought most Idaho snowpacks close to where they need to be this time of year. But some areas of the state could still face slightly below-normal irrigation supplies this year, concludes the first monthly water-supply analysis of 2009.

Bozeman’s Gill wins national title

Published January 8, 2009, 10:51 pm, Bozeman Daily Chronicle

ANCHORAGE, Alaska — Katie Gill, of the Bridger Ski Foundation, won what amounted to a national championship by finishing first in the girls junior sprint race Thursday at the U.S. Cross Country Ski Championships, the final day of the event.
